Cyprus - Median Equivalised Net Income (Before Social Transfers Including Pensions) of Households without Dependent Children
Since 2014, Cyprus Median Equivalised Net Income (Before Social Transfers Including Pensions) of Households without Dependent Children jumped by 3.5% year on year. At €10,055 in 2019, the country was ranked number 16 among other countries in Median Equivalised Net Income (Before Social Transfers Including Pensions) of Households without Dependent Children. Cyprus is overtaken by France, which was number 15 with €10,951 and is followed by Italy at €9,604. Iceland lead the ranking with €36,409 in 2019, a decrease of 1.1% versus 2018. Switzerland, Norway and Denmark resp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Romania witnessed the best average annual growth at +15.3% per year, while Turkey recorded the worst performance at -4.2% per year.
